Как создать пользователя в MySQL Ubuntu: пошаговое руководство
Чтобы создать пользователя в MySQL на Ubuntu, выполните следующие шаги:
- Откройте терминал.
- Войдите в MySQL, используя следующую команду:
- Введите пароль для учетной записи root.
- Создайте нового пользователя с помощью следующей команды:
- Дайте пользователю необходимые разрешения. Например, чтобы предоставить пользователю все разрешения, используйте следующую команду:
- Обновите привилегии с помощью следующей команды:
- Выходите из MySQL с помощью следующей команды:
mysql -u root -p
Эта команда позволит вам войти в MySQL под учетной записью root.
CREATE USER 'имя_пользователя'@'localhost' IDENTIFIED BY 'пароль';
Замените "имя_пользователя" на желаемое имя пользователя и "пароль" на желаемый пароль.
GRANT ALL PRIVILEGES ON * . * TO 'имя_пользователя'@'localhost';
Замените "имя_пользователя" на имя пользователя, которому вы хотите предоставить разрешения.
FLUSH PRIVILEGES;
EXIT;
Теперь у вас есть новый пользователь в MySQL!
Детальный ответ
Как создать пользователя в MySQL на Ubuntu
Добро пожаловать! В этой статье мы обсудим, как создать пользователя в MySQL на Ubuntu. Будем следовать официальной документации и использовать команды в терминале для выполнения данной задачи.
Шаг 1: Установка MySQL на Ubuntu
Перед тем, как мы начнем, убедитесь, что у вас уже установлен MySQL на вашем сервере Ubuntu. Если MySQL еще не установлен, вы можете установить его с помощью следующей команды:
sudo apt-get update
sudo apt-get install mysql-server
Шаг 2: Вход в MySQL
После успешной установки MySQL, вы можете войти в систему, используя следующую команду:
mysql -u root -p
Вы будете попросены ввести пароль для пользователя root. Введите пароль и нажмите Enter.
Шаг 3: Создание пользователя
После входа в систему MySQL, вы можете создать нового пользователя с помощью команды CREATE USER
. Вам нужно указать имя пользователя и пароль пользователя.
CREATE USER 'имя_пользователя'@'localhost' IDENTIFIED BY 'пароль';
Здесь 'имя_пользователя'
- это имя, которое вы хотите назначить новому пользователю, и 'пароль'
- это пароль, который вы хотите установить для этого пользователя. Замените их соответственно вашими значениями.
Также вы можете использовать '%'
вместо 'localhost'
, чтобы разрешить доступ к пользователю с любого хоста.
Шаг 4: Предоставление привилегий пользователю
После создания пользователя, вы можете предоставить ему необходимые привилегии с помощью команды GRANT
. Привилегии могут варьироваться в зависимости от того, какие действия ваш новый пользователь будет выполнять в базе данных.
Для примера, предоставим новому пользователю все привилегии на все таблицы базы данных:
GRANT ALL PRIVILEGES ON *.* TO 'имя_пользователя'@'localhost' WITH GRANT OPTION;
После этого не забудьте обновить привилегии:
FLUSH PRIVILEGES;
Шаг 5: Выход из MySQL
Когда вы закончите работу с MySQL, вы можете выйти из системы, набрав команду exit;
.
Заключение
Теперь вы знаете, как создать пользователя в MySQL на Ubuntu. Помните, что безопасность важна, и следует назначать надлежащие привилегии каждому пользователю в соответствии с его потребностями.
Удачи в изучении MySQL!